Understanding the Price of the Patek Philippe 6300G-001
The $134,000+ price tag for the Patek Philippe 6300G-001 is not simply a reflection of the materials used or the labor involved. It's a multifaceted equation incorporating several crucial elements:
* Rarity and Exclusivity: The Grandmaster Chime is an extremely limited production piece. Its complexity necessitates a painstaking manufacturing process involving numerous highly skilled artisans, significantly restricting the number of watches produced annually. This scarcity naturally drives up demand and value. The "G" in the reference number indicates a white gold case, adding another layer of exclusivity to this already rare timepiece.
* Grand Complication Status: The 6300G-001 belongs to the elite category of grand complications. This designation signifies the watch's incorporation of multiple complex functions beyond the basic timekeeping mechanism. In this case, the Grandmaster Chime boasts a staggering array of complications, including a grand sonnerie, petite sonnerie, minute repeater, and alarm, all orchestrated with remarkable precision. The sheer engineering prowess required to integrate these functions seamlessly contributes significantly to the watch's value.
* Hand-Finished Movement: Every component of the Patek Philippe 6300G-001's movement is meticulously hand-finished by highly skilled watchmakers. This painstaking process, often taking hundreds of hours per watch, ensures the highest levels of precision, reliability, and aesthetic appeal. The level of artistry and attention to detail is simply unmatched in mass-produced timepieces.
* Materials and Craftsmanship: The use of precious metals like white gold for the case, along with the highest-quality materials for the dial, hands, and movement components, further enhances the watch's value. The intricate hand-engraving and guilloché work on the dials are testaments to the dedication and artistry involved in the creation of this masterpiece.
